A big part ofYaoling: Mythical Journeyis travelling around the world to recruit NPCs to live in your village. These NPCs will provide you with helpful services, such as hunting lodges and shops. Unfortunately, most of these NPCs will require some saving, usually from a tough demonic Yaoling that you must face.
Caulie is a chef who can be found to the south of the starting village. When you meet her, though, it becomes apparent that you must save her from a tough rabbit-like Yaoling called the Terrigaze. Fortunately, this fight isn’t anything to write home about as long as you’ve done some preparation.

How To Beat Terrigaze
Terrigaze (also called Terrorgaze) is likely the first demon Yaoling that you’ll fight in the game. Withover 1,000 HPand a tough move in Wilting Barrage, this can be a long fight if you don’t have the right preparations taken care of.
The key to beating Terrigaze is tomake sure you have a full party- you can deployfive Yaolingsto the fight, and you’ll begin the game with four.Catching aLaventotin the first area south of the village should bring you up to this round number.
Youcannot catch demons, so don’t waste time or Seal Charms trying to!
Remember that to fill spaces in your party, you’ll need totake Yaolings from your storagevia a Spirit Shrine.
If you are still struggling with this fight, don’t be afraid to useHealing Charmson any Yaolings that get low on health! The extra bit of survivability will go a long way to making the fight more bearable.
Upon your success, Caulie will join your village andopen up a restaurantwhen spoken to. This will allow you to eat buffing meals and also earn money by putting your Yaolings to work. In addition,Caulie will give you a fishing rod, unlocking the ability to fish for Yaolings and crafting materials.
